A jury in Chester once put a wooden statue on trial for murder. They found it guilty, sentenced it to drown, and threw it into the River Dee. A medieval chronicler swore he survived, slipped away, and lived out his days as a hermit right here.
These are the kind of stories waiting on this self-guided audio walking tour of Chester. You explore at your own pace with our app as your guide, no fixed start time and no group to keep up with.
